US Plasticizers Market Overview:
As per MRFR analysis, the US Plasticizers Market Size was estimated at 3.34 (USD Billion) in 2023. The US Plasticizers Market Industry is expected to grow from 3.7(USD Billion) in 2024 to 6.5 (USD Billion) by 2035. The US Plasticizers Market CAGR (growth rate) is expected to be around 5.256%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035).

US Plasticizers Market Drivers
Increase in Demand from Automotive Industry
The US Plasticizers Market Industry is significantly driven by the increasing demand from the automotive sector. According to the American Automobile Manufacturers Association, the US automotive industry's contribution to the economy amounts to over 3 million jobs and a value-added of around 495 billion USD. This growth leads to a higher utilization of plasticizers in the production of safer, lighter, and more fuel-efficient vehicles. The demand for high-performance plasticizers is expected to increase as vehicles are designed for better insulation and more flexible materials, aligning with the stricter environmental regulations set forth by the Environmental Protection Agency aimed at reducing automotive emissions.Moreover, with the rise of electric vehicles expected to represent about 30% of the new car sales by 2030, the corresponding need for advanced materials, including plasticizers, will drive further growth in the US Plasticizers Market Industry.
Rising Construction Activities
The US Plasticizers Market Industry is also propelled by the robust recovery and expansion of the construction sector. The US Census Bureau reported that construction spending is anticipated to reach approximately 1.5 trillion USD in 2024, reflecting a steady increase from previous years. Plasticizers play a critical role in manufacturing flexible and durable construction materials, thus supporting this market. The growing initiatives for infrastructure development and affordable housing projects, driven by government incentives and the bipartisan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act aiming to allocate 1.2 trillion USD for rebuilding Americaโs roads and bridges, will inevitably enhance the demand for plasticizers in construction applications.

Plasticizers Market Type Insights
The US Plasticizers Market is diversely segmented by Type, specifically focusing on Phthalate Plasticizers and Non-Phthalate Plasticizers. Phthalate Plasticizers hold a significant position in the market due to their widespread use in manufacturing flexible polyvinyl chloride (PVC) products, which find application in various industries such as construction, automotive, and consumer goods. The demand for Phthalate Plasticizers is primarily driven by their effectiveness in enhancing the flexibility and durability of plastics. However, rising concerns regarding environmental and health impacts associated with phthalates have led to increased scrutiny and regulatory measures. In contrast, Non-Phthalate Plasticizers have been gaining traction as safer alternatives to traditional phthalate compounds within the US market. This segment is significant for industries seeking compliance with stringent regulations and for companies aiming to market more environmentally friendly products. The growing awareness among consumers about sustainable practices is propelling the demand for Non-Phthalate Plasticizers, as manufacturers pivot towards greener formulations in order to meet both regulatory standards and consumer expectations. As the market evolves, both segments are shaping the landscape of the US Plasticizers Market, with Non-Phthalate Plasticizers emerging as a viable solution to conventional plasticizers while addressing environmental and safety concerns. Plasticizers Market Application Insights
The Application segment of the US Plasticizers Market plays a vital role in various industries due to its versatile nature. Key areas include Flooring and Wall Covering, which significantly enhance durability and flexibility, making them essential for residential and commercial spaces. Wire and Cable applications leverage plasticizers for improved performance in electrical insulation and flexibility, crucial for modern connectivity. The Packaging sector benefits from plasticizers to provide enhanced sealability and flexibility, contributing to the sustainability of food and consumer goods.Consumer Goods encompass a wide range of products where plasticizers improve usability and comfort. In Medical and Healthcare, these materials are vital for the manufacturing of medical devices and equipment that require safety and sterility. The Toys segment emphasizes the need for safe, flexible materials that align with regulatory standards, while Other applications cover a multitude of uses across diverse industries, reflecting the adaptable nature of plasticizers. US Plasticizers Market Industry Developments
In recent months, the US Plasticizers Market has experienced significant developments with a strong focus on sustainability and regulatory pressures. Companies such as OQ Chemicals and BASF are advancing efforts to produce bio-based plasticizers, responding to the increasing demand for environmentally friendly alternatives. ExxonMobil and Eastman Chemical are also enhancing their product portfolios to align with market trends towards reduced volatility and improved efficiency in plasticizer performance. In October 2023, Mitsubishi Chemical announced a partnership aimed at developing innovative plasticizer solutions to meet changing consumer preferences. There have been notable mergers and acquisitions in the market; in September 2023, Kraton Corporation announced its acquisition of a bio-based plasticizer unit to enhance its market position. Moreover, in July 2022, Afton Chemical expanded its footprint by acquiring a competing specialty chemical manufacturer.
